Andrew Garfield is getting honest about what it is like to be a part of a global franchise such as “Spider-Man”. After oing into “The Amazing Spider-Man” films, Garfield recalled to The Guardian that in the process he got his “heart broken a little bit.” “I went from being a naive boy to growing up.
How could I ever imagine that it was going to be a pure experience?” he explained. “There are millions of dollars at stake and that’s what guides the ship.
